Freddy Cole on Tuesday 9 O'Clock Special

Freddy ColeHe's been called the best male jazz singer of the last 15 years and a true gentleman of song. Freddy Cole, Nat's younger brother, is a living link to the Great American Songbook. His suave and sophisticated singing and uptown swagger on the piano guarantee an evening of toe tapping enjoyment.
